source: https://www.securityfocus.com/bid/47277/info

Fiberhome HG-110 is prone to a cross-site scripting vulnerability and a directory-traversal vulnerability because it fails to sufficiently sanitize user-supplied input.

Exploiting these issues will allow an attacker to execute arbitrary script code in the browser of an unsuspecting user in the context of the affected site and to view arbitrary local files and directories within the context of the webserver. This may let the attacker steal cookie-based authentication credentials and other harvested information, which may aid in launching further attacks.

Fiberhome HG-110 firmware 1.0.0 is vulnerable other versions may also be affected. 

The following example URIs are available:

http://www.example.com/cgi-bin/webproc?getpage=%3Cscript%3Ealert%28this%29%3C/script%3E&var:menu=advanced&var:page=dns

Local File Include and Directory/Path Traversal:

-
http://www.example.com/cgi-bin/webproc?getpage=../../../../../../../../../../../../etc/passwd&var:menu=advanced&var:page=dns
